India, Aug. 26 -- The third edition of India Health 2026, India's flagship healthcare exhibition, opened at Bharat Mandapam, New Delhi, and brought together over 300 domestic and international brands and 8,000-plus healthcare and MedTech professionals.

The event backed India's ambition to become a global healthcare and manufacturing hub, with the sector's economy projected to reach Rs 110.21 trillion by FY27. Dubai Health Authority's participation as an exhibitor spotlighted deepening India-UAE healthcare ties.

Various speakers from AMTZ, AHPI, ADMI and Informa spoke about the potential and challenges of patient-centric care, digital transformation, and India's growing medical-device manufacturing base.
